Wordpieces 4.3
4
matr “mother”
5
matron Noun A married woman
6
maternal Adjective Having the qualities of a mother; motherly
Synonym: nurturing Antonym: uncaring
7
matriculate verb To enroll in a degree program, especially at a college
8
patr “father”
9
patronize Verb Definition 1: To regularly give business to
Definition 2: To talk down to; condescend
10
paternal Adjective Having the qualities of a father synonym: fatherly
Antonym: uncaring
11
patricide Noun The murder of a father
12
cide = killer; act of killing
homicide matricide fratricide pesticide/herbicide suicide genocide
13
expatriate Noun A person living outside his or her native country
Synonym: emigrant Antonym: native
14
fil “son, child”
15
filial Adjective Having to do with a son or child
16
filicide Noun Act of a parent killing a child
17
affiliate/affiliation
Noun One related to or associated with Synonym: partner Antonym: rival
18
gen “give birth to; create”
19
progenitor noun The founder of a line or race Synonym: forefather
Antonym: descendant
20
progeny noun Children or descendants Synonym: offspring
21
genealogy Noun The study of families and descendants
22
genetics Noun The study of heredity [characteristics passed down from parent to offspring]
